複数の行を挿入しようとしましたが、データベースに空の行があり、その他のエラーが発生しました。だから、内破を(より良い代替手段として?)使用しようとしましたが、ここで何か間違ったことをしているに違いありません。
$sql = array();
foreach($_POST as $key => $value ) {
$sql[] = '("'.sqlite_escape_string($key['cust_name']).'", '.$key['address'].')';
}
$stmt = $db->prepare('INSERT INTO customers VALUES (cust_name, address) '.implode(','. $sql));
$stmt->execute($sql);